Abstract
The utility model discloses a special bounce rectification device for high-precision drill repair, which comprises a first adjustable center hole component which is constituted of a first center hole structure, a first adjustment structure and a first clamping structure in sequence and a second adjustable center hole component which is constituted of a second center hole structure, a second adjustment structure and a second clamping structure which are connected in sequence, wherein the first adjustment structure and the second adjustment structure respectively adjust positions of the first center hole structure and the second center hole structure, can determine a main shaft of the high-precision drill needing to be repaired flexibly and efficiently, calibrate the precision of tools needing to be repaired and reach requirements for the concentricity of the high-precision drill.

Background technology
In high accuracy drill bit renovation technique, before repairing cutter, need measure the cutter that will repair, determine physical length, radius, diameter and the main shaft axial location of cutter, to guarantee to repair precision and the quality of cutter.But, technique centre bore or counter center while having removed original manufacture due to the many high accuracy drill bits that need repair, or original centre bore can not meet the tool precision requirement while repairing after use, so must carry out calibration tool with adjustable center aperture apparatus.

The specific embodiment
Below in conjunction with accompanying drawing, preferred embodiment of the present utility model is described in detail, thereby so that advantage of the present utility model and feature can be easier to be it will be appreciated by those skilled in the art that, protection domain of the present utility model is made to more explicit defining.
Refer to Fig. 1, Fig. 2 and Fig. 3, the utility model embodiment comprises:
The high accuracy drill bit reparation special use deviation correcting device of beating, comprising: the first adjustable center hole parts 1 and the second adjustable center hole parts 2;
The first adjustable center hole parts 1, comprise the first center hole structure 11, the first adjustment structure 12 and the first clamping structure 13 that are connected successively;
The structure of the first adjustable center hole parts 1 is:
The first center hole structure 11 is the cylinder that cross section is provided with boss, what on described cylinder, be connected with process equipment main shaft is the first boss, the first boss axis part is with holes, what on described cylinder, be connected with the first adjustment structure 12 is the second boss, is evenly distributed with four grooves on the cylindrical circumference of the first center hole structure 11;
The first adjustment structure 12 is divided into three parts, comprise: disc, lock-screw and adjustment screw, described disc is evenly distributed with four screws circumferential, and four screws are all perpendicular to axial direction, described disc is distributed with four screws along even circumferential on cross section, and described screw is corresponding with the groove on described the first center hole structure 11 circumference;
The first clamping structure 13 is solid cylinder, and the first end of the first clamping structure 13 is connected in the trying to get to the heart of a matter of disc of the first adjustment structure 12, and the second end of the first clamping structure 13 is with rectangular recess;
The second boss of the first center hole structure 11 embeds in the disc of the first adjustment structure 12, adjustment screw contacts with described the second boss through the screw on the first adjustment structure 12 circumference, described lock-screw is screwed into the screw on the first adjustment structure 12 cross sections by the groove on the first center hole structure 11, the first centre bore 11 structures and the first adjustment structure 12 lockings, the second end clamping of the first clamping structure 13 needs the cutter head of the cutter 3 of reparation.
The second adjustable center hole parts 2, comprise the second center hole structure 21, the second adjustment structure 22 and the second clamping structure 23 that are connected successively.
The structure of the second adjustable center hole parts 2 is:
The second center hole structure 21 is the cylinder that cross section is provided with boss, what on described cylinder, be connected with process equipment main shaft is the first boss, described the first boss axis part is with holes, what on described cylinder, be connected with the second adjustment structure 22 is the second boss, is evenly distributed with four grooves on the cylindrical circumference of the second center hole structure 21;
The second adjustment structure 22 is divided into three parts, comprise: disc, lock-screw and adjustment screw, described disc is evenly distributed with four screws circumferential, and four screws are all perpendicular to axial direction, described disc is distributed with four screws along even circumferential on cross section, and described screw is corresponding with the groove on the second center hole structure 21 circumference;
The second clamping structure 23 is cylindrical body, and the first end of the second clamping structure 23 is connected in the trying to get to the heart of a matter of disc of the second adjustment structure 22, and the second end side surface of the second clamping structure 23 is axially arranged with screw;
The second boss of the second center hole structure 21 embeds in the disc of the second adjustment structure 22, described adjustment screw contacts with described the second boss through the screw on the second adjustment structure 22 circumference, described lock-screw is screwed into the screw on the second adjustment structure 22 cross sections by the groove on the second center hole structure 21, the second center hole structure 21 and the second adjustment structure 22 lockings, the second end clamping of the second clamping structure 23 needs to repair the handle of a knife of cutter.
The described high accuracy drill bit reparation special use deviation correcting device of beating, in use, the first boss of the first boss of the first center hole structure 11 and the second center hole structure 21 is embedded respectively in the main shaft of process equipment, make in the rotating main shaft that is positioned at described process equipment in the two ends of described deviation correcting device, need the handle of a knife of the cutter 3 of reparation to be fixed in the second adjustable center hole parts 2, then with amesdial contact clip, be held in the cutter head of the cutter in the groove of the first clamping structure 13, then be rotated, size and the direction of amesdial dial plate registration during according to the head of indicator contact cutter, use the adjustment screw in the first adjustment structure 12 and the second adjustment structure 22, adjust respectively the position of the first center hole structure 11 and the second center hole structure 21, until dial reading swings in the franchise of tool precision.
Due in the course of the work, with the higher amesdial of precision calibrate, concentricity precision can reach 0.002mm, and the described high accuracy drill bit reparation special use deviation correcting device of beating has very strong flexibility and applicability, the first adjustment structure 11 and the second adjustment structure 22 four-ways are adjustable, and easy to operate, so be also to reach than being easier to for the required precision of the cutter of need reparation.
